486,558 is a composite number, even.
486,558 (four hundred eighty-six thousand five hundred fifty-eight) is an even 6-digit number. It is a composite number with 12 divisors, and factors as 2 × 3² × 27,031. Its proper divisors sum to 567,690,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x76C9E.
